Field Cottage is a picturesque Victorian semi-detached cottage tucked down a private track in the heart of Meonstoke, within the South Downs National Park. The house offers a welcoming living room with exposed brick fireplace, a second reception with wood-burning stove, and a country-style kitchen leading to a useful study and ground-floor cloakroom —comfortable living for a growing family in a peaceful village setting.

On the first floor are four bedrooms and a single family bathroom; the principal bedroom benefits from dual aspect windows and good wardrobe space. Recent restoration work includes the double‑glazed sash windows, and the garden and driveway for two cars are notable practical assets for rural life. Local schools rated Good–Outstanding and village amenities suit family routines and outdoor activities.

Buyers should note the property’s older construction: granite/whinstone walls are likely uninsulated and the home uses oil-fired supply (not community) with electric storage heaters, so energy efficiency improvements would be advisable. It sits in a conservation area, which preserves character but may limit external alterations. There is only one bathroom for four bedrooms and council tax is above average — factors to consider for family households or buyers planning to refurbish.

Overall, this is a characterful, well-situated cottage with good garden space and parking, suited to buyers who value village life and are prepared to invest in energy upgrades or sensitive refurbishment to maximise comfort and long-term value.
